This episode of Getting to 3rd Space is Part 2 of our conversation with Christie Vilsack, writer, teacher, Former First Lady of Iowa, and sponsor of the Navy’s U.S.S. Iowa, a nuclear submarine.
Our conversation continues with a focus on literacy, acts of kindness, and the benefits of growing up in rural America. Christie writes the Substack column, “Common Ground,” in which she tells stories of the people she has met and the ties that connect them. A link to her Substack is provided below.
